Output 8ca9bb9435bf088258279bd2ca6dccc24943caac4fc15efdedeb526abb70fa0c:10

value
534582370
script pubkey
OP_0 OP_PUSHBYTES_32 27605607dbeb0327e17a04461996c8c1043db823c95335dfb4a23daae02ea7a6
address
bc1qyas9vp7mavpj0ct6q3rpn9kgcyzrmwpre9fntha55g764cpw57nqlt3c3m
transaction
8ca9bb9435bf088258279bd2ca6dccc24943caac4fc15efdedeb526abb70fa0c
confirmations
304164
spent
true